The DDCMasterTest periodically verifies whether configured ports on the DDC are available or not, and if so how quickly it responds to connection requests. In addition, the test also reports whether the DDC being monitored is the 'master' of a farm. This page depicts the
default parameters that need to be configured for the DDCMasterTest and appears
on clicking the CONFIGURE DEFAULT button beside this test in
the CONFIGURE TESTS page.
-
In
the TARGETPORTS text box, specify either a comma-separated list of
port numbers that are to be tested (eg., 80,7077,1521), or a comma-separated list of port name:port number pairs that are to be tested (eg., smtp:25,mssql:1433). In the latter case, the port name will be displayed in the monitor interface. Alternatively, this parameter can take a comma-separated list of port name:IP address:port number pairs that are to be tested, so as to enable the test to try and connect to Tcp ports on multiple IP addresses. For example, mysql:192.168.0.102:1433,egwebsite:209.15.165.127:80.
- If the ISPASSIVE flag is set to Yes, then the server under consideration is a passive server in an Oracle cluster. No alerts will be generated if the server is not running. Measures will be reported as "Not applicable' by the agent if the server is not up.
- Specify the duration (in seconds) in the TIMEOUT text box beyond which the this test will time out if a response is not received from the DDC. The default is 60 seconds.
